- Meaning of Hawaiian word Kokua | Ola Properties
It means to cooperate and pitch in without regard for self and to have consideration for others The word kokua may also be used to refer to a person who helps or a caregiver Often, you will see signs that say, “please kokua,” or please help
- Meaning of Kokua: The Hawaiians Generosity in Heart
Kokua is a Hawaiian word that means to help others In a more profound sense, it means giving your time and energy freely to help better the lives of others and your community
